Man shot dead in Anambra for stealing lipstick, maggi

A suspected armed robber was fatally shot by security personnel on Sunday morning in Awka, the capital of Anambra State.

The incident occurred around 6 a.m. near the Bamboo Bus Stop in Ifite village, following reports of a robbery targeting early morning churchgoers.

According to sources, the suspect had robbed three women of their handbags before the confrontation with security forces.

Items recovered from his possession after the shooting included a lipstick, ₦600, a Nokia torch phone, and two cubes of Knorr seasoning, all believed to have been stolen from the victims.

One of the victims, who works at a popular joint in Awka, recounted her harrowing experience, stating that the robbery was executed by a three-man gang that accosted her at gunpoint as she was returning home from work.

Another victim, a churchgoer, was targeted just as she stepped out of her lodge.

“They approached me, demanding to know what was in my bag. The girl going to church saw what was happening and threw her bag into the bush. The robbers found my phone and money and took everything. They then ordered me to run without looking back,” the victim narrated.

As she fled toward the bush, one of the robbers chased her, while the other two pursued the churchgoer. It was at this point that a local security officer intervened, firing at one of the robbers and killing him instantly. The remaining two gang members managed to escape.

As of the time of this report, the Anambra State Police Command has yet to release an official statement regarding the incident.
